Milestone Leadership - Operations Coordinator

Position summary: Essential member of the Milestone Leadership team responsible for supporting the operational needs of the organization. This role also supports our finance processes and customer relationship software, and provides project coordination as necessary.

This role is part-time and flexible, primarily remote with some in-person team meetings and customer programs. There is potential for this role to grow as the company grows and to add additional responsibilities based on the employee’s skill set and interests. Position responsibilities: 

  • Operational support for the organization, which may include:
  • Managing supplies
  • Supporting Project Coordinators in program preparation and logistics
  • Managing company inbox, calendar, and voicemail
  • Travel logistics
  • Other duties as assigned
  • Finance support, which may include:
  • Monitor and manage expense receipt process in partnership with accountant
  • Monitor and manage invoice tracking process
  • Assist Partners in reconciling monthly P&L reports with annual budget
  • Serve as liaison between Accountant and Milestone team – includes monthly submission of hours for payroll
  • Provide regular updates and reports as requested
  • Assist in developing efficient financial management and reporting processes
  • Occasional project coordination:
  • Planning, logistics, and implementation of Milestone Leadership programs as necessary
